Our museum is located in the Depot in Village Square. The Village began to be developed in 1851 - the same year that the Cincinnati, Hamilton & Dayton Railroad was finished. For a time Glendale was the terminus of the C.H. & D. Village life was closely entwined with that of the Railroad. Enjoy browsing through Glendale's history.
